The King is about to get challenged from a QSR once known for Mayor McCheese.


McDonald’s is the prime mover in the latest Media Monitors Spot Ten Cable report, for the week ending April 29.

This activity puts the golden arches back in the Spot Ten, at No. 6, with 31,272 spots.

It’s a message to Burger King, which holds steady at No. 3.

Also in the mix among QSRs is Taco Bell, at No. 4.

Meanwhile, Flo and her understudy Jaime are out to get the gecko.

Progressive is a strong No. 2 to GEICO with 45,387 spots — making it the only brand other than its big-spending rival investing in more than 40,000 plays at spot cable.

Liberty Mutual and State Farm are also present, making auto insurance a key category for spot cable.
